Main duties of the job
Assess, diagnose and manage the on-going care of an agreed caseload of patients within the specialist area. In particular, care will be provided to patients with:
o Late/end stage complications arising from diabetic foot disease and inflammatory arthropathies resulting in complex deformity requiring therapeutic footwear provision.o Circulatory and neurological deficits and reduced tissue viability e.g. pressure ulcers, requiring specialist off loading and footwearo Complex medical conditions, e.g. Peripheral vascular disease which potentially has a major impact on foot pathology.
The post holder will be expected to have an identified caseload of patients, the majority of which will be for patients with diabetes and have associated complications and to undertake all associated communication with other healthcare professionals and the diabetes multi-disciplinary team.Prescribe therapeutic stock and modified stock footwear and advise and be involved in made to measure footwear provision.To participate in the education, training and supervision of other staff in association with therapeutic footwear.
